摘要:
一、背景 随着网站访问量增加,仅仅靠增加机器已不能满足系统的要求,于是需要对应用系统进行垂直拆分和水平拆分。在拆分之后,各个被拆分的模块如何通信?如何保证 性能?如何保证各个应用都以同样的方式交互?这就需要一种负责各个拆分的模块间通信的高性能服务框架(HSF)。 二、HSF做的事情 1. 标准Ser 阅读全文
posted @ 2016-02-18 22:37
人生设计师
阅读(1267)
评论(0)
推荐(0)
摘要:
事务就是一个会话过程中,对上下文的影响是一致的,要么所有的更改都做了,要么所有的更变都撤销掉。就要么生,要么死。没有半死不死的中间不可预期状态。 参考下薛定谔的猫。 事务是为了保障业务数据的完整性和准确性的。 分布式事务,常见的两个处理办法就是两段式提交和补偿。 两段式提交典型的就是XA,有个事务协 阅读全文
posted @ 2016-02-18 22:11
人生设计师
阅读(242)
评论(0)
推荐(0)
摘要:
负载主机可以提供很多种负载均衡方法,也就是我们常说的调度方法或算法: 轮循(Round Robin) 这种方法会将收到的请求循环分配到服务器集群中的每台机器,即有效服务器。如果使用这种方式,所有的标记进入虚拟服务的服务器应该有相近的资源容量 以及负载形同的应用程序。如果所有的服务器有相同或者相近的性 阅读全文
posted @ 2016-02-18 22:08
人生设计师
阅读(3653)
评论(0)
推荐(0)
摘要:
HSF提供的是分布式服务开发框架,taobao内部使用较多,总体来说其提供的功能及一些实现基础:1.标准Service方式的RPC 1)、Service定义:基于OSGI的Service定义方式 2)、TCP/IP通信: IO方式:nio,采用mina框架 连接方式:长连接 服务器端有限定大小的连接 阅读全文
posted @ 2016-02-18 22:06
人生设计师
阅读(4429)
评论(0)
推荐(0)
摘要:
http://my.oschina.net/u/1185331/blog/502350 阅读全文
posted @ 2016-02-18 08:37
人生设计师
阅读(216)
评论(0)
推荐(0)

浙公网安备 33010602011771号